Get PriceThe guard in Figure 2 covers the pinch point and the moving parts of the tail pulley. If properly maintained, this design can prove ef fective in preventing contact during work-related activities. Figure 2 6 Figure 3 shows an elevated tail pulley. Because the underside of the pulley is accessible, it needs to be guarded.

Get PriceThe bypass belt conveyor was equipped with an 8.5-inch diameter self-cleaning tail pulley (see Appendix C). The bypass belt conveyor can feed the horizontal shaft impactor at the plant or bypass the impactor and recirculate the rock back to the cone-crusher. Investigators found the belt conveyor in the bypass mode at the time of the accident.

Get PriceThe conveyor speed was 93 feet per minute in an east to west direction. The tail pulley guard had been removed and was lying on the ground adjacent to the tail pulley. When installed, the guard effectively prevented access to the pinch point at the tail pulley and also allowed access to the conveyor adjustment screws.
